Python 3 Text Processing with NLTK 3 Cookbook: Over 80 practical recipes on natural language processing techniques using Python's NLTK 3.0
4.5
بر اساس نظر کاربران
شما میتونید سوالاتتون در باره کتاب رو از هوش مصنوعیش بعد از ورود بپرسید
هر دانلود یا پرسش از هوش مصنوعی 2 امتیاز لازم دارد، برای بدست آوردن امتیاز رایگان، به صفحه ی راهنمای امتیازات سر بزنید و یک سری کار ارزشمند انجام بدینمعرفی کتاب
کتاب Python 3 Text Processing with NLTK 3 Cookbook اثری جامع و عملی از جیکوب پرکینز است که بر روی پردازش زبان طبیعی (NLP) با استفاده از کتابخانه NLTK در Python متمرکز شده است. این کتاب با بیش از ۸۰ دستورالعمل عملی به شما کمک میکند تا مهارتهای خود را در زمینه پردازش متون ارتقاء دهید. با بهرهگیری از پیشرفتهای جدید در نسخه 3.0 NLTK و قدرت Python 3، این کتاب برای کسانی که به دنبال بهبود تواناییهای خود در حوزه NLP هستند، منبعی بینظیر فراهم کرده است.
خلاصهای از کتاب
این کتاب شامل مجموعهای از دستورالعملهای مرحله به مرحله است که به شما کمک میکند تا با ابزارها و تکنیکهای مختلف پردازش متنی آشنا شوید. از مفاهیم پایه پردازش زبان طبیعی تا تکنیکهای پیشرفته مانند دستهبندی متون، ریشهیابی، و تحلیل احساسات، تمامی جنبهها در این کتاب پوشش داده شدهاند. هر بخش از کتاب با نمونه کدهای واقعی و توضیحات جامع پشتیبانی میشود که به خواننده این امکان را میدهد تا مفاهیم را به سرعت درک کند و در پروژههای خود به طور مؤثر به کار گیرد.
نکات کلیدی
- آشنایی عمیق با NLTK و نحوه استفاده از آن برای پردازش زبان طبیعی
- یادگیری تکنیکهای مختلف NLP و پیادهسازی آنها در Python
- کار با دادههای متنی و آمادهسازی آنها برای تحلیلهای پیشرفته
- ساخت و بهبود مدلهای دستهبندی متن
- بررسی و مقایسه میان ابزارها و تکنیکهای مختلف NLP
نقل قولهای معروف از کتاب
“پردازش زبان طبیعی یک هنر و علم است، و با استفاده از Python و NLTK شما میتوانید از هر دو جنبه این رشته به خوبی بهرهمند شوید.”
“از طریق ترکیب ابزارهای مناسب و دانشی که از این کتاب به دست میآورید، میتوانید به سرعت در مسیر تبدیل شدن به یک متخصص NLP قدم بردارید.”
چرا این کتاب مهم است
با توجه به رشد روز افزون دادههای متنی و اهمیت تحلیل آنها در صنایع مختلف، تسلط بر پردازش زبان طبیعی اهمیت ویژهای یافته است. کتاب Python 3 Text Processing with NLTK 3 Cookbook به عنوان یک راهنمای جامع و کاربردی، ابزار و تکنیکهای لازم را برای موفقیت در این مسیر فراهم میکند. با بیش از ۸۰ دستورالعمل عملی و پوشش جامع مباحث NLP، این کتاب به شما کمک میکند تا در زمینه تحلیل دادههای متنی مهارت پیدا کنید و در پروژههای خود به نقاط قوت جدیدی دست یابید.
Introduction
In an era dominated by unceasing streams of textual information, the ability to process and interpret human language at scale is transformative. "Python 3 Text Processing with NLTK 3 Cookbook" offers an in-depth guide into the world of natural language processing (NLP) using Python 3 and the Natural Language Toolkit (NLTK) 3.0. This extensive cookbook is crafted to provide readers with a wealth of practical knowledge, allowing them to harness NLP magic to transform text into meaning.
Detailed Summary of the Book
With over 80 practical recipes, this book empowers both beginners and experienced programmers to delve into text processing. Starting with the basics of installing Python and NLTK, the book gradually introduces more complex topics such as tokenization, stemming, and POS tagging. Each recipe is designed to address specific NLP tasks, providing a step-by-step approach to solving problems, optimizing code, and enhancing performance. Furthermore, the book covers advanced topics, including sentiment analysis, machine learning integration, and deploying NLP models into real-world applications. By breaking down intricate tasks through practical examples, readers will gain the confidence and skills needed to tackle various NLP challenges using Python.
Key Takeaways
- Understand the core concepts of NLP and how to implement them using Python and NLTK.
- Explore the intricacies of text mining, from document classification to extracting useful insights.
- Master the art of building customized NLP solutions through practical, real-world examples.
- Learn to integrate and deploy NLP models in production environments efficiently and effectively.
- Enhance your ability to preprocess, analyze, and visualize complex text data.
Famous Quotes from the Book
"The beauty of natural language processing lies not in its complexity, but in its ability to make the chaotic understandable."
"Every text is a puzzle waiting to be solved, and NLTK provides us with the pieces."
Why This Book Matters
In a digital age where data is more available than ever, understanding and manipulating textual data is crucial for businesses and researchers alike. "Python 3 Text Processing with NLTK 3 Cookbook" stands out as an indispensable resource for anyone serious about diving into NLP with Python. It not only equips readers with the technical skills required to build robust text processing systems but also fosters an understanding of the underlying linguistic principles that govern human language. By blending theory with practice, this book helps bridge the gap between academia and industry, offering a comprehensive toolkit for data scientists, developers, and linguists.
Moreover, as data becomes more text-rich, the skills acquired from this book will be crucial in various domains such as customer support automation, sentiment analysis in marketing, and even in aiding legal and medical fields with large-scale document categorization. The recipes within serve as both an educational guide and a reference manual, ensuring they remain relevant as NLP technologies evolve.
دانلود رایگان مستقیم
برای دانلود رایگان این کتاب و هزاران کتاب دیگه همین حالا عضو بشین